Hullo fellow fly-fishing & Quobba nuts

Thought I’d share this with you, since it’s so rare these days to get a good fish past the greycoats on a fly-rod at Quobba these days (also cos I’d like to brag about it a bit ).

Couldn’t get a weight on it but this guy went exactly 120cm (4 foot) – which is supposedly 20.9kg according to the SASAA Species Calculator, which seems to be the most conservative one I can find. My guess would have been more like 17kg. Who knows.......
